In modern web development, incorporate optical identifiers like Commonwealth Flag Icons Npm packages has become a standard necessity for user experience design. Whether you are building an e-commerce platform that require nation selection for shipping, a multilingual application that needs speech toggle, or a worldwide dashboard displaying international exploiter metric, having entree to a high-quality library of vector or raster fleur-de-lis image is all-important. By utilizing the Node Package Manager (npm) ecosystem, developer can streamline their workflow, ensuring that their assets are version-controlled, easy updateable, and ready for deployment within modernistic frontend fabric like React, Vue, or Angular.
Understanding the Benefits of Using NPM Packages for Flag Icons
Care asset manually frequently leave to issue with inconsistent naming normal, fragmentise file route, and difficult update. When you use Country Flag Icons Npm packages, you concentrate your dependance management. This access offer several distinct vantage for scalable software architecture:
- Version Control: Easily upgrade or downgrade your image library across different environments.
- Tree Shaking: Modern libraries allow you to import simply the iris you need, significantly trim bundle size.
- Ordered Styling: Most npm libraries provide exchangeable sizing, aspect ratios, and color profiles.
- Community Support: Open-source packet are frequently update to include new or updated flags, assure geopolitical accuracy.
Popular Implementation Strategies
Developers mostly prefer between SVG-based image and image-based image. SVGs are preferred in modern-day projects due to their scalability and ability to be falsify via CSS. Utilize an npm bundle insure that these SVGs are optimize for the web, often including pre-configured exportation scope that save you hr of manual optimization work.
| Feature | SVG Ikon | Raster Icons (PNG/JPG) |
|---|---|---|
| Scalability | Perfect (Resolution Independent) | Poor (Pixelated when zoomed) |
| Performance | High (Inline or Sprite) | Variable (Requires HTTP request) |
| Styling | CSS-customizable | Limited |
Selecting the Right Library for Your Project
When seek for the better Country Flag Icons Npm resources, it is crucial to evaluate the sustainer's activity grade and the library's compatibility with your specific tech peck. Look for packages that provide TypeScript definition, as these will significantly enhance your development experience by supply autocompletion and type guard during the consolidation phase.
💡 Billet: Always ensure the license file in the node_modules folder to ascertain the icon set complies with your projection's commercial-grade requirements.
Step-by-Step Integration Workflow
- Format your project with
npm initif you haven't already. - Install the elect iris library use
npm install [package-name]. - Importee the necessary flag portion or asset forthwith into your beginning file.
- Apply global way or specific course names to ensure logical alinement with your live UI kit.
Optimizing Performance for Global Applications
If your coating function a global audience, execution is paramount. Load century of flag at once can affect your Largest Contentful Paint (LCP). Enforce lazy loading for fleur-de-lis icons or habituate a sprite-based approach can drastically meliorate your situation's speed. By leveraging an npm-based workflow, you can automate the coevals of these faerie, making your build procedure more efficient.
Frequently Asked Questions
Comprise flag icons via npm provides a robust, scalable, and maintainable answer for professional web evolution. By standardizing your picture management, you trim proficient debt, meliorate the developer experience, and check that your coating stay ordered across all locale. Whether you prefer a simple SVG wrapper or a more complex sprite scheme, the key to success prevarication in choosing a well-maintained library that aligns with your performance needs and design spec. Proper implementation of these asset will conduct to a more nonrational and visually appealing interface for your users, regardless of where they are in the world. As the ecosystem continues to evolve, these package will stay critical tools in the modernistic developer's toolkit, serve through enowX Labs.
Related Terms:
- bootstrap state flags
- country flag icon free
- flag icon library
- all commonwealth flags download
- commonwealth masthead icons svg
- country flag unicode